For the price, the OnePlus Pad punches well above its weight class in comparison to tablets in the same ballpark. Going toe to toe with the likes of Samsung’sGalaxy Tab S7, it features hardware powerful enough to deliver a responsive and smooth performing device, and even features compatibility with accessories like external keyboards and stylus pens. What really helps set the OnePlus Pad apart, however, is the larger 11.6-inch 2800x2000 144Hz LCD screen that features a 7:5 aspect ratio.

Getting the keyboard case for free here only enhances this key feature of the OnePlus Pad, since the larger screen and aspect ratio make it ideal for using in horizontal modes. Streaming your favorite shows or browsing the web comes easiest in this orientation, so turning the OnePlus Pad into a tablet laptop hybrid only makes sense. Plus, the display is fairly similar to theGoogle PIxel Tabletin many ways, however it’s a bit larger and offers a higher resolution for clearer images, which makes it even better as a media or productivity tablet.

Along with the impressive image quality and screen size, the OnePlus Pad does also feature OnePlus' signature fast charging tech and a sizable battery life that offers quite a bit more juice than competing tablets. The larger 9,150mAh battery pack delivers a staggering amount of run time for a tablet of this caliber, offering close to all-day use on a single charge. If you do need a quick boost to the battery, however, it features 67W fast-charging to get you back in the game quickly.
